As an HR professional, your first responsibility is to collect all nomination forms and declarations from employees as part of the Joining Kit. Additionally, you should prepare policies regarding leave, overtime (OT), Prevention of Sexual Harassment (POSH), etc. Submit the notice of opening (Form A) to the labor department under the Gratuity Act. Ensure timely payment of monthly contributions for Provident Fund (PF) and Employee State Insurance Corporation (ESIC) by the 15th of every month. Maintain statutory registers and forms in accordance with the Factory/Shop & Establishment Act and display all necessary statutory notices on the premises. It is crucial to plan and conduct training sessions for employees, covering both soft skills and technical training.
